  4. Finally got to see Pacific Crests full show since I missed sneak preview. The show feels like an evolution upon last year style wise. Trumpet quartet during the tap dancing section is solid, and get some good Madison-esque screaming going during a park and bark. Beautiful ballad with a euph small ensemble and mello soloist. Great closer too with some explosive drill. Wish they were louder, they sound so good but are noticeably quieter than Mandarins/Troopers. Also, first pc wave drill set since 2013, great to see the return of that.

  7. Quick highlights from open class:

    Vessel - brand new corps, they have good numbers and had a fun show. Hope they can grow in this impacted socal open class scene. 

    Golden Empire: they're growing and improving, always good to see them

    Watchmen: I think this is the biggest corps they've fielded. Great show from them, much more mature design from them than past years.

    Gold: holy crap. They're looking like a world class corps. Huge hornline (76?), mature design. May not keep up with scvc/bdb but they could be looking at a promotion soon.
